Too Much Income in Retirement Can Cost You
Too Much Income in Retirement Can Cost You Taxes don’t stop in retirement. Income thresholds can trigger taxes on Social Security, higher Medicare premiums and lost deductions. On this episode of Countdown to Retirement, Gregg MacInnis explains how strategies like Roth conversions can help coordinate income and withdrawals—so there are no surprises down the road. How the Three Stages of Your Financial Life Can Drive Your Retirement
How the Three Stages of Your Financial Life Can Drive Your Retirement Did you know there are three stages to your financial life? They are called accumulation, preservation and distribution. The first two – saving and safeguarding money – feed into the third, which funds your retirement. Why Retirement Savers Miss Pensions
Why Retirement Savers Miss Pensions The 401(k) was never meant to be a retirement plan. It was intended to be a savings plan for retirement. But when companies reverted to 401(k)s from traditional pensions, they left the concept of guaranteed income behind.
